{Tools: Make Up For Ever Foundation, Mascara, & High Definition Powder, NARS Orgasm Blush, Urban Decay’s Naked Palette, Aveda Eyeliner in Black Orchid, Chanel Lipstick in Baby Gold.}







Here’s how to do it:
Step 1: Apply foundation, blush, and finishing powder to your face as normal.
Step 2: Mix Urban Decay’s Naked Palette colors Sin and Toasted, along with NARS Orgasm blush for a peach eye color.
Step 3: Line your eyes with a dark eyeliner and a couple of coats of mascara.
Step 4: Finally, finish off the look with a dark nude/gold lip.
